verb “control”

control; he controls; past controlled, part. controlled; ger. controlling
  1. kontrollera
    She controls the volume of the music with her phone.
  2. begränsa
    To stay healthy, she controls her sugar intake.
  3. behärska sig
    Despite the frustration, she controlled herself and spoke calmly.
  4. kontrollera (genom att minimera påverkan av yttre variabler)
    In their study on diet and heart health, the researchers controlled for age and exercise habits to isolate the effects of food intake.

substantiv “control”

sg. control, pl. controls or uncountable
  1. kontroll
    She lost control of the car on the icy road.
  2. kontrollenhet (eller styrorgan)
    To adjust the volume, simply turn the volume control on the radio to the right.
  3. självkontroll
    She practiced deep breathing exercises to maintain control during the speech.
  4. säkerhetsåtgärder
    Implementing strong password controls is essential for protecting our network from unauthorized access.
  5. referens (i betydelsen jämförelsestandard)
    In the study on the new diet's effectiveness, the control was fed a standard diet to compare results.
